Hawaii Supreme Court Upholds Election Results, Rejects Maui Candidate’s Signature Dispute Claim

Honolulu, Hawaii — The Hawaii Supreme Court recently handed down a ruling that upheld the general election results for a Maui County Council seat, dismissing a challenge by candidate Kelly King. King, who lost her bid for the council position last month by a narrow margin of 97 votes, had contested the legitimacy of the election process. In her lawsuit, King argued that an excessive number of ballots were improperly discarded due to issues with signatures being missing or deemed invalid.
